Ordering heather shirts for DTF: check the fabric behind each color

One style name does not prove one fabric blend

Check the material specification for the exact shirt color you intend to buy. A manufacturer may use different fiber blends within a product family. For example, Gildan’s G1100OPP listing describes its solids as 100% cotton and its heathers as 90% cotton and 10% polyester.

That is a specific manufacturer example, not a rule for every heather shirt or an endorsement of that blank for Transfer305. The useful habit is to read the style-and-color specification and confirm the label on the actual garment.

Build a blank list before the transfer list

Field What to record
Identity Manufacturer and exact style code
Color The supplier’s color name or code
Composition The fiber percentages for that color
Other limits Care label, finish and any decoration instructions
Design Final dimensions and placement approved for that blank

Send this information when checking your project with Transfer305. A fiber label helps define the job; it is not a complete compatibility test.

Treat a substitute color as a check, not an automatic approval

In a hypothetical order, 14 solid-color shirts are replaced with 14 heather shirts because of availability. The quantity has not changed, but the material may have. Keep the replacement separate in the order record until its composition, appearance and application plan are confirmed.

Use the artwork guide to review the design against the chosen garment color. For repeat work, retain the blank specification with the approved file so a later substitution is visible.
